My Mother Taught Me
A lesson changed my life
When I think back to my childhood, one particular memory stands out vividly — the day my mother taught me a valuable life lesson. It was a warm, sunny afternoon, and I must have been around ten years old. We were in the garden, tending to the plants, when I carelessly knocked over a pot, shattering it into pieces.
I was immediately filled with guilt and shame, fearing my mother’s anger and disappointment. However, to my surprise, she didn’t scold me or show any signs of frustration. Instead, she calmly knelt down beside me and began picking up the broken pieces. Her serene demeanor puzzled me, but it was what she said next that left a lasting impact on my young mind.
“Accidents happen, and it’s okay to make mistakes,” she gently said, her reassuring voice soothing my troubled heart. “What truly matters is how we handle these situations and learn from them.”
She continued to clean up the mess with patience and grace, explaining that life would present us with challenges and obstacles, some of which might be of our own making. But it’s not about avoiding them entirely; it’s about facing them with courage and resilience.
As she spoke, I felt a sense of relief and understanding wash over me. My mother’s wisdom made me realize that making mistakes was a natural part of life’s journey, and it shouldn’t define my self-worth. Instead, it presented an opportunity for growth and learning.
From that day forward, I carried my mother’s lesson with me, approaching each obstacle with a newfound sense of optimism. I embraced challenges, knowing that they were stepping stones towards becoming a better version of myself. It didn’t mean that I stopped making mistakes altogether, but I shifted my perspective, seeing them as opportunities for growth rather than reasons for self-doubt.
Looking back now, I am grateful for that simple yet profound lesson my mother taught me. It has shaped my character, instilling in me the belief that resilience, forgiveness, and continuous learning are the cornerstones of personal development.
Key Message: Her gentle guidance on that sunny afternoon has stayed with me through the years, a constant reminder of the strength that lies within us to overcome life’s adversities and emerge stronger on the other side.
